Blue light is scattered in all directions by the tiny molecules of air in Earth's atmosphere. Blue is scattered more than other colors because it travels as shorter, smaller waves. This is why we see a blue sky most of the time.
When light comes from the sun, all these light waves of different wavelengths travel through empty space. When they reach Earth’s atmosphere, the light waves can interact with particles in the air like dust, water droplets, and ice crystals. Because of the extremely small size of visible light waves (less than one millionth of a meter), these light waves also interact the tiny gas molecules that make up the air itself. The light waves bounce off these particles just like you might bounce and get jostled in a busy hallway. As the light waves bounce in lots of different directions, we say they have been scattered.
Within the visible range of light, red light waves are scattered the least by atmospheric gas molecules. So at sunrise and sunset, when the sunlight travels a long path through the atmosphere to reach our eyes, the blue light has been mostly removed, leaving mostly red and yellow light remaining. The result is that the sunlight takes on an orange or red cast, which we can see reflected from clouds or other objects as a colorful sunset (or sunrise).Small particles of dust and pollution in the air can contribute to (and sometimes even enhance) these colors, but the primary cause of a blue sky and orange/red sunsets or sunrises is scattering by the gas molecules that make up our atmosphere. Large particles of pollution or dust scatter light in a way that changes much less for different colors. The result is that a dusty or polluted sky is usually more grayish white than blue.
